The third season of Beyblade X lands on October 24 and brings a brand new soundtrack. Fans hear the first notes of the opening song "Invincible" performed by i ...
Polyphonic on MSN

Breaking Down 'Feel Good Inc.'

"Feel Good Inc." by Gorillaz offers a stark critique of modern consumerism and the digital revolution. This video analyzes how the song, blending genres like hip-hop, funk, and rock, takes on ...